如何利用程序开发提升项目效率与交付速度

D
dashen79 2021-11-28T19:23:24+08:00
0 0 184

在现代软件开发中,利用程序开发工具和技术可以大大提升项目的效率和交付速度。本文将介绍一些如何利用程序开发提高项目效率的方法。

1. 使用现代化的开发工具和技术

选择适合项目需求的现代化开发工具和技术,可以显著提升开发效率。例如,使用集成开发环境(IDE)可以提供强大的代码编辑、调试和测试功能,可以节省开发人员在编写和调试代码上的时间。同时,使用版本控制工具(如Git)可以更好地管理代码变更,简化代码合并和团队协作过程。

另外,选择现代化的技术栈(如React、Angular、Vue等)可以提供更高效的开发框架和工具,使开发人员能够更快地构建前端界面。

2. 自动化测试和部署

通过自动化测试可以帮助我们在开发过程中更早地发现和解决问题,减少后期修复和调试的时间。利用单元测试、集成测试和端到端测试等各种测试技术,可以快速验证代码的正确性和稳定性。

此外,自动化部署可以减少人工部署过程中的错误和手动操作时间。通过使用自动化部署工具(如Jenkins、Travis CI等),可以快速、可靠地将代码部署到生产环境中。

3. 使用开源工具和框架

利用开源工具和框架可以节省项目开发过程中的时间和精力。开源工具和框架已经被广泛测试和使用,具有成熟的功能和可靠性。通过使用这些工具和框架,我们可以避免从头开始构建一些常见的功能,并且可以更快地开发出高质量的代码。

例如,使用开源UI库(如Bootstrap、Material UI等)可以快速构建漂亮且响应式的用户界面;使用开源数据库(如MySQL、PostgreSQL等)可以方便地进行数据存储和查询。

4. 敏捷开发和迭代

敏捷开发和迭代开发方法可以提高项目的透明度和灵活性,从而更好地满足客户的需求。通过将项目拆分成小的迭代周期,开发团队可以更频繁地与客户进行沟通和反馈,及时调整项目方向和优先级。

同时,利用敏捷开发工具和技术(如Scrum和Kanban)可以更好地管理和跟踪项目进度、任务分配和工作流程,提高项目管理效率。

5. 优化和性能调优

针对项目中的瓶颈和性能问题进行优化和性能调优,可以提升项目的运行效率和响应速度。通过使用性能调试工具和监控工具,可以找出项目运行过程中的性能瓶颈,并进行相应的优化。

此外,优化数据库查询、减少网络请求、采用缓存等技术手段也可以提升项目的效率和响应速度。

结论

通过利用程序开发工具和技术,我们可以显著提高项目效率和交付速度。选择适合项目需求的现代化开发工具和技术、自动化测试和部署、使用开源工具和框架、敏捷开发和迭代,以及优化和性能调优,都是提升项目效率的有效方法。在实际项目中,可以根据具体情况灵活应用这些方法,提高项目的效率和质量。

相似文章

    评论 (0)